The online repository with latest Squid 4.13 (rebuilt from Debian unstable with 
sslbump support) for Ubuntu 18 LTS 64-bit is available at squid413.diladele.com.
Github repo at https://github.com/diladele/squid-ubuntu contains the scripts we 
used to make this compilation.
Scripts for Ubuntu 20 and Ubuntu 16 are also available in that repo.

Here are simple instructions how to use the repo. For more information see 
readme at https://github.com/diladele/squid-ubuntu .

# add diladele apt key
wget -qO - http://packages.diladele.com/diladele_pub.asc | sudo apt-key add -

# add repo
echo "deb http://squid413.diladele.com/ubuntu/ bionic main" > 
/etc/apt/sources.list.d/squid413.diladele.com.list

# update the apt cache
apt-get update

# install
apt-get install squid-common
apt-get install squid
apt-get install squidclient
